Go to latestPinned post – 4.52AMBefore the Bell: ASX to open lowerTimothy MooreAustralian shares are set to open lower, tracking modest weakness on Wall Street as traders there await June’s jobs data. Federal Reserve chairman Kevin Warsh said “inflation risks have come down” during a panel appearance in Portugal.ASX 200 futures were down 26 points or 0.3 per cent to 8684 near 4.45am AEST. The S&P 500 was little changed near 2.45pm in New York.A key semiconductor index slumped more than 6 per cent after Bloomberg reported that Meta Platforms is developing plans for a cloud infrastructure business.Market highlightsASX 200 futures are pointing down 26 points or 0.3 per cent to 8684.All US prices near 2.45pm New York time.AUD -0.4% to US68.95¢Bitcoin +2.8% to $US60,144On Wall St: Dow +0.1% S&P -0.02% Nasdaq -0.4%VIX -0.03 to 16.42Gold +1.4% to $US4062.88 an ounceBrent oil -2% to $US71.48 a barrelIron ore -1.1% to $US97.90 a tonne10-year yield: US 4.48% Australia 4.78%Today’s agendaMay’s trade data will be released at 11.30am AEST.The focus will be on the US June payrolls report at 10.30pm AEST.
